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from North Queensferry to Danzey start from as little as £26.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from North Queensferry to Danzey start from £180.00 one way, or £181.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from North Queensferry to Danzey are available for £191.70 one way, or £371.60 return

Facilities and Amenities

North Queensferry train station is equipped to make your journey as seamless as possible. Although there isn't a ticket office, you can collect your pre-purchased tickets or buy them directly using the available ticket machines, which are accessible to everyone. For passengers requiring assistance with hearing, an induction loop system is in place for a better travel experience. CCTV cameras provide an added layer of security, guaranteeing peace of mind during your time at the station.

While waiting for your train, you can relax in the seating area. However, it's worth noting there are no accessible toilets or baby changing facilities, so planning ahead is advised. Car parking is available 24/7 with 13 free spaces, including one designated for Blue Badge holders.

Accessibility

North Queensferry station scores reasonably well on accessibility, featuring a Category B classification, which indicates partial step-free access. Ramps provide access to platforms, but a connecting footbridge with stairs is present for crossing between platforms. If you require additional assistance, bookings for help can be organized through the easy-to-navigate Passenger Assist service.

Onward Travel Options

Connecting with other modes of transportation from North Queensferry is straightforward. Taxis can be booked through resources like TrainTaxi. However, if your journey demands a bus service, further details about bus routes and schedules can be found at Traveline Scotland or by contacting them directly at 0871 200 22 33.

For those travelling when rail services are replaced, convenient rail replacement buses pick up and drop off from the car park at Platform 1, ensuring no destination is out of reach.

Facilities and Amenities at Danzey Station

Danzey station offers a basic range of amenities aimed at providing essential services for travelers. It doesn't have a ticket office or machines, so it's advisable to purchase your tickets online or before arriving at the station. Help & support is available via the customer help points and departure screens at the station, making it easier to find information when needed. Whilst staff presence is limited, an induction loop is available, accommodating hearing-impaired travelers by providing clear announcements.

For those with mobility concerns, Danzey offers partial step-free access ensuring smooth movement across certain areas. The station is categorized as step-free access category B3. Convenient ramp services help users board trains, and seating areas offer a spot to relax while waiting for your service. Moreover, with three accessible parking spaces close by, parking is more accommodating for those requiring mobility support.

Travel Connections: Getting to and from Danzey

In terms of onward travel, rail replacement services are available from Danzey Green Lane, easily accessible from the station car park entrance, making it a viable option during service interruptions. Although there are no local buses directly from the station, you can plan your journey with available information in a printable format. If you prefer a quicker mode of transit, local taxi services from Henley (dial 01564 793338) offer another convenient option.
